You only think it is because that's all you see.07-04-13 12:25 PMLike 3 - People who expected Blackberry to explode and take over the phone market with the Z10/Q10 are obviously not thinking logically. RIM fell out of the market. They didn't do much on the phone front for the last 3 years until now. The general public's perception (US anyway) of Blackberry is quite bland because of that. So thinking they would knock one out of the park in 3 months time is .. well, not thinking. The only way Blackberry is going to take market share at this point is slowly but surely. And, if they don't throw some money on marketing for these and future products, it's going to be far slower than even they (Blackberry) expected (just as it did with the latest quarterly report) ..
